react怎么动态渲染一个div内的html

发布于 2022-09-01 13:01:40 字数 434 浏览 6 评论 0

问题的背景如下:
前端技术react。
页面中有一个div

<div className="editable" data-placeholder="内容..." ref="content">{this.state.data.content}</div>

{this.state.data.content}的内容是由后端通过json格式传送过来,其实内容是html格式。
期望的显示效果是在前台显示出带有格式的html效果,可是现在的效果却如下:

clipboard.png

请问这种需求正确的做法是什么样的?

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(2

带刺的爱情 2022-09-08 13:01:40
function createMarkup() { return {__html: 'First · Second'}; };
<div dangerouslySetInnerHTML={createMarkup()} />

官方的例子!
地址如下:http://reactjs.cn/react/tips/dangerously-set-inner-html.html

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文